ABOUT FIREFLY AEROSPACE
Firefly Aerospace is a space and defense technology company on a mission to reliably and repeatedly launch, land, and operate space systems from Earth to the Moon and beyond. As the partner of choice for critical space missions, Firefly is the first commercial company to launch a satellite to orbit with 24-hour notice and the first company to achieve a successful Moon landing. Headquartered in north Austin, Texas, Firefly is looking for passionate, hardworking innovators to join our team and help fuel our successful trajectory into space.
SUMMARY
As the Spacecraft ADCS Manager at Firefly Aerospace, you will lead a technical team supporting attitude control system design, analysis, and flight operations for spacecraft in LEO and cislunar space. In this role, you will own all aspects of team leadership including recruitment, career development, and performance management while driving strategic planning, budget management, and operational execution. This position combines technical expertise in spacecraft attitude determination and control with organizational leadership, requiring you to build team capabilities, foster a high-performing culture, and deliver mission-critical support in a fast-paced aerospace environment.
R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Lead an ADCS team supporting multiple spacecraft programs and development efforts
  • Set ADCS objectives and communicate priorities to team members and cross-functional stakeholders
  • Interface with program managers and mission stakeholders to allocate team responsibilities and establish execution schedules
  • Drive ADCS strategy and roadmap development, identifying capability gaps and investment priorities
  • Champion continuous improvement initiatives for ADCS processes, tools, and operational efficiency
  • Direct daily operations of the team ensuring timely delivery of mission-critical software development, analysis, and operational support
  • Develop and manage the ADCS budget and annual operating plan
  • Own all aspects of team staffing including hiring, onboarding, and workforce planning
  • Conduct performance evaluations and drive career development through mentorship and coaching of engineers at all levels
  • Foster a healthy team culture and maintain high morale in a demanding technical and operational environment

QUALIFICATIONS
Required
  • Bachelor's degree in aerospace engineering, m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, physics, mathematics, or related field
  • 10+ years of experience in spacecraft ADCS with demonstrated expertise across guidance, navigation, and control system design
  • 5+ years of technical leadership experience including directing the work of other engineers and technical staff
  • Demonstrated experience supporting operational spacecraft missions through multiple mission phases
  • Demonstrated success building team capabilities through mentorship, training, and career development
  • Experience managing team budgets, resource planning, and workforce forecasting
  • Experience establishing technical standards, processes, and best practices for ADCS organizations
  • Excellent communication skills with ability to convey complex technical concepts to executives, customers, and non-technical stakeholders
  • Ability to foster a collaborative team culture while meeting demanding mission schedules

Desired
  • Advanced degree (master's or PhD) in aerospace engineering, m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, physics, mathematics, or related field
  • Knowledge of spacecraft subsystems and their impact on attitude control system design and performance
  • Proven ability to recruit, hire, develop, and retain high-performing technical talent
  • Experience with Python and Linux
  • Proficiency in real-time software development using C++ for mission-critical applications
  • Experience developing strategic vision, technical roadmaps, and upgrade initiatives for ADCS teams
  • Experience leading or supporting anomaly investigations and resolving critical mission issues
